Astronomy began 10,000 years ago in Australia

Scientists have discovered a 10,000-year-old Aboriginal monument, possibly the world's oldest astronomical observatory.

50 kilometers southwest of Melbourne, there is an ancient stone monument, believed to be perhaps the world's first astronomical observatory.

Made by the indigenous people Aborigines of the region, the Wurdi Youang, as the attraction is called, consists of a series of stone columns, aligned with important phases of the solar cycle, that mark seasonal changes, such as sunrooms and the equinoxes.

There are over 100 stones, arranged in a circle with a diameter of approximately 50 meters.

Researchers estimate the observatory to be 10,000 years old, making it possibly the oldest surviving observatory in the world.

The observatory appears to have been constructed by the indigenous people of Australia. Wathaurong, which has been inhabited since 25,000 BC.

The tribe's culture collapsed in the 18th century, mainly due to the settlement of Europeans in the area, and its last members passed away a century later.

Scientists are working to accurately determine the age of the observatory, believing that it may be considerably older than a similar one. Egyptian monument, the stone circle of Nabta Playa, which dates back to 5,000 BC.

This location is important because, among other things, it debunks the myths that Australia's first inhabitants were simple hunters and gatherers, demonstrating the deep and sophisticated understanding of nature and complex systems that they ultimately possessed.

Despite the lack of historical data on the reasons for the construction of this particular site, studies to date show that The placement of the rocks at points corresponding to the solstices and equinoxes could only have been done deliberately.
